FCX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

1,453 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Freeport-McMoran (FCX)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$55.3B — up 11% from $49.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 167 funds opened new FCX positions and 122 closed out — a net gain of 45 holders — while 610 added to existing stakes and 494 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Franklin Resources, adding an estimated $707M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$668M.
